蜘蛛池是一种高效的搜索引擎优化工具,通过模拟搜索引擎爬虫抓取网页信息,帮助用户快速获取目标网站的数据。该工具支持多种搜索引擎,如谷歌、百度等,并提供了多种查询方式,如关键词查询、URL查询等。用户只需在蜘蛛池官网注册账号并登录,即可使用其提供的各种功能,如批量查询、定时查询等。蜘蛛池还提供了详细的查询结果分析,帮助用户更好地了解目标网站的情况。蜘蛛池是一款非常实用的网络爬虫工具,适用于各种SEO优化和网站分析需求。
在数字化时代,网络爬虫(Web Crawler)已成为数据收集、分析和挖掘的重要工具,而蜘蛛池(Spider Pool)作为网络爬虫的一种高效组织形式,更是为数据获取提供了强大的支持,本文将深入探讨蜘蛛池查询的概念、工作原理、应用场景以及如何利用这一工具进行高效的数据采集。
一、蜘蛛池查询的基本概念
1.1 什么是蜘蛛池
蜘蛛池,顾名思义,是一个集中管理和调度多个网络爬虫(即“蜘蛛”)的集合,这些爬虫可以分布在不同的服务器或虚拟环境中,通过统一的接口进行管理和控制,蜘蛛池的核心优势在于其高度可扩展性、资源优化以及任务分配的灵活性。
1.2 蜘蛛池的工作原理
蜘蛛池通过以下步骤实现高效的数据采集:
任务分配:管理员将需要爬取的任务(如特定网站、关键词搜索等)分配给各个爬虫。
资源调度:根据任务的复杂度和优先级,蜘蛛池动态调整爬虫的数量和分配。
数据收集:各个爬虫根据分配的任务进行网页抓取和数据解析。
数据存储:收集到的数据经过清洗和整理后,存储到指定的数据库或数据仓库中。
结果反馈:爬虫将爬取结果返回给蜘蛛池,由蜘蛛池进行进一步的处理或分发。
二、蜘蛛池查询的优势
2.1 提高爬取效率
通过集中管理和调度多个爬虫,蜘蛛池能够显著提高数据爬取的效率,多个爬虫可以并行工作,从而缩短数据采集的周期。
2.2 灵活的任务分配
蜘蛛池支持动态的任务分配和负载均衡,能够根据任务的复杂度和优先级进行实时调整,确保资源的有效利用。
2.3 强大的扩展性
随着爬虫数量的增加,蜘蛛池的扩展性使其能够轻松应对大规模的数据采集任务,满足复杂多变的数据需求。
2.4 高效的数据管理
蜘蛛池提供统一的数据存储和查询接口,方便用户对采集到的数据进行管理和分析,还支持数据的持久化存储和备份,确保数据的安全性。
三、蜘蛛池查询的应用场景
3.1 电商数据分析
在电商领域,蜘蛛池可用于收集竞争对手的产品信息、价格、销量等关键数据,帮助企业制定有效的市场策略,通过爬取某电商平台上的商品信息,企业可以了解市场趋势和消费者偏好,从而调整产品结构和营销策略。
3.2 搜索引擎优化(SEO)
SEO人员可以利用蜘蛛池进行网站内容的监控和分析,通过爬取目标网站的页面结构和内容,评估其SEO效果,发现潜在的问题并进行优化,还可以监控竞争对手的关键词排名和网站流量,为SEO策略的调整提供数据支持。
3.3 舆情监测
在舆情监测方面,蜘蛛池能够实时爬取各大新闻网站、社交媒体和论坛上的相关信息,帮助企业及时了解和应对舆论变化,通过爬取微博上的热门话题和评论,企业可以迅速掌握公众对其品牌和产品的看法和态度。
3.4 学术研究和数据分析
在学术研究和数据分析领域,蜘蛛池可用于收集大量的公开数据和文献资源,通过爬取学术论文数据库和学术搜索引擎,研究人员可以快速获取最新的研究成果和学术趋势,还可以利用蜘蛛池进行大规模的社会科学调查和数据挖掘项目。
四、如何构建和使用蜘蛛池查询系统
4.1 系统架构
一个典型的蜘蛛池查询系统通常包括以下几个关键组件:爬虫管理模块、任务调度模块、数据存储模块和查询接口模块,爬虫管理模块负责爬虫的注册、启动和停止;任务调度模块负责任务的分配和负载均衡;数据存储模块负责数据的存储和备份;查询接口模块提供数据的查询和分析功能,系统还需要具备高可用性和可扩展性设计以应对大规模的数据采集任务,可以采用分布式架构和负载均衡技术来提高系统的性能和稳定性,同时还需要考虑数据安全和隐私保护问题以确保用户数据的安全性和合规性,在实际应用中可以根据具体需求进行定制开发以满足特定的应用场景和要求,例如针对电商数据分析可以开发专门的商品信息抓取模块;针对SEO优化可以开发网站内容分析模块等,此外还可以集成各种第三方服务和工具如API接口、数据库管理系统等以扩展系统的功能和性能,通过构建和使用高效的蜘蛛池查询系统可以大大提高数据采集和分析的效率和质量从而为企业和个人带来更大的商业价值和社会效益,综上所述可以看出蜘蛛池查询作为一种高效的网络爬虫组织形式在数字化时代具有广泛的应用前景和巨大的商业价值,通过合理利用这一工具我们可以更好地挖掘和利用网络上的海量数据为各行各业的发展提供有力的支持,同时我们也需要注意遵守相关法律法规和道德规范以确保数据采集的合法性和合规性避免对他人造成不必要的困扰和损失。